As an Account Executive you will be an integral member of the Accounts team by providing support and assistance in managing the client’s business and ensuring that day to day activities run smoothly. The Account Executive sets the tone for how the account is managed by assuring focus on key client objectives and actively contributes and supports Account Supervisor(s) and Account Director(s).

Accountabilities:

  • Supports Account Supervisor and wider team with general client liaison and administration; builds project estimates, client contact reports, work back schedules, etc.
  • Coordinates and schedules meetings and is responsible for weekly status report upkeep
  • Coordinate creative and production teams dedicated to the project
  • Updates plans with feedback from clients. Updates and distributes documents as needed
  • Builds trusting, collaborative relationships with clients at appropriate levels
  • Performs competitive research and produces reports
  • Develops campaign post-mortem documents by liaising with media, strategy, creative and production
  • Admin management of projects under his / her remit: from docket creation, to invoicing to financial reconciliation of mandates
  • Performs other duties, as assigned

Qualifications:

  • University degree in administration, communications, or marketing
  • 1-2 years of relevant work experience in similar function
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Highly adaptable and able to perform in a dynamic environment
  • Comfortable working independently with strong organizational and prioritization skills; Quick learner and detail oriented
  • Proficient using Office suite (Word, Excel, Outlook) and Keynote
  • Prior experience in automotive or retail as a bonus

Additional information: The salary range for this position is $50-60k. Actual salary within the salary range will be based on a variety of factors including relevant experience, knowledge, and skills. A range of medical, dental, RRSP, paid time off, and/or other benefits also are available to all permanent employees. What you need to know about the Toronto Tech Scene

Although home to some of the biggest names in tech, including Google, Microsoft and Amazon, Toronto has established itself as one of the largest startup ecosystems in the world. And with over 2,000 startups — more than 30 percent of the country's total startups — Toronto continues to attract new businesses. Be it helping entrepreneurs manage their finances, simplifying business operations by automating payroll or assisting pharmaceutical companies in launching new drugs, the city's tech scene is just getting started.
